Gmunden is an Austrian town, capital of the district of the same name, in Upper Austria. It is located in the region of Salzkammergut on the shores of Lake Traunsee. It is situated next to the lake Traunsee on the Traun River and is surrounded by high mountains, including the Traunstein. Gmunden was granted city status in 1278. The city is known, among other things, as the place of origin of the Gmunden ceramic.
